The Foundation

For over seventy years, the Lewis family has built homes and neighborhoods across Southern California. This foundation exists for what a neighborhood needs beyond its houses.

Established by Randall and Janell Lewis, the foundation continues a philanthropic tradition begun by Ralph and Goldy Lewis in 1955, supporting the institutions, programs, and people that make the Inland Empire a healthier, better-educated, and more creative place to live. We do not accept unsolicited proposals; our giving grows out of long relationships with the communities we know best.

The flagship program

The Randall Lewis Health Policy Fellowship

Now in its 16th year, the fellowship places graduate students in public and community health inside the cities and agencies of the Inland Empire, giving emerging leaders real policy work, and giving communities talent they could never otherwise afford.
